From: Charles Keepax <ckeepax@opensource.wolfsonmicro.com>
To: Mark Brown <broonie@kernel.org>
Cc: Carlo Caione <carlo@caione.org>,
boris.brezillon@free-electrons.com, sameo@linux.intel.com,
linux-doc@vger.kernel.org, emilio@elopez.com.ar,
dmitry.torokhov@gmail.com, wens@csie.org, lgirdwood@gmail.com,
hdegoede@redhat.com, linux-sunxi@googlegroups.com,
linux-input@vger.kernel.org, maxime.ripard@free-electrons.com,
lee.jones@linaro.org, linux-arm-kernel@lists.infradead.org
Subject: Re: [PATCH v4 7/9] ARM: sun7i/sun4i: dt: Add AXP209 support to various boards
Date: Thu, 24 Apr 2014 17:35:23 +0100 [thread overview]
Message-ID: <20140424163523.GB25663@opensource.wolfsonmicro.com> (raw)
In-Reply-To: <20140424133036.GY12304@sirena.org.uk>
On Thu, Apr 24, 2014 at 02:30:36PM +0100, Mark Brown wrote:
> On Wed, Apr 23, 2014 at 10:25:46PM +0200, Carlo Caione wrote:
>
> > I'm having a really hard time with this problem, so any hint is welcome
> > :) The small modification I'm using on top of the patches in this series
> > is here: http://bpaste.net/show/228330/
>
> > Unfortunately as I said I got this when booting:
> > http://bpaste.net/show/nUhUTzELT32v9HNPathL/
>
> Huh, actually the arizona drivers do show this (it was being masked in
> my logs by another unrelated bug). I guess the Wolfson guys aren't
> working with upstream much (though Charles did write the orignal code
> here...).
I run upstream fairly regularly here (although mostly on Arndale
rather than Speyside). On closer inspection of my kernel log
don't seem to have anything related to it, which is odd.
> The issue is the MFD core, it shouldn't be using managed allocations
> here - the error reported by the assert is entirely correct. If the
> CODEC driver is bound and unbound it'll not be possible to reload it
> as things stand.
>
> Your driver is correct but the implementation needs to be fixed -
> possibly with an API change on free since at the minute the cells to be
> freed don't get passed back into the MFD core when deallocating.
This does indeed look broken, I will have a look and think about it.
Unfortunately I am travelling most of next week, so if I don't
manage to get something out over the weekend there may be a slight
delay on me getting a fix out.
Thanks,
Charles
next prev parent reply other threads:[~2014-04-24 16:35 UTC|newest]
Thread overview: 37+ messages / expand[flat|nested] mbox.gz Atom feed top
2014-04-11 9:38 [PATCH v4 0/9] mfd: AXP20x: Add support for AXP202 and AXP209 Carlo Caione
[not found] ` <1397209093-10077-1-git-send-email-carlo-KA+7E9HrN00dnm+yROfE0A@public.gmane.org>
2014-04-11 9:38 ` [PATCH v4 1/9] mfd: AXP20x: Add mfd driver for AXP20x PMIC Carlo Caione
[not found] ` <1397209093-10077-2-git-send-email-carlo-KA+7E9HrN00dnm+yROfE0A@public.gmane.org>
2014-04-11 11:25 ` Arnd Bergmann
2014-04-11 12:03 ` [linux-sunxi] " Carlo Caione
2014-04-11 12:09 ` Mark Brown
[not found] ` <20140411120908.GC28800-GFdadSzt00ze9xe1eoZjHA@public.gmane.org>
2014-04-11 13:16 ` Arnd Bergmann
2014-04-16 15:43 ` Lee Jones
2014-04-16 15:44 ` Lee Jones
2014-04-11 9:38 ` [PATCH v4 2/9] dt-bindings: add vendor-prefix for X-Powers Carlo Caione
2014-04-11 9:38 ` [PATCH v4 3/9] mfd: AXP20x: Add bindings documentation Carlo Caione
2014-04-11 9:38 ` [PATCH v4 4/9] input: misc: Add driver for AXP20x Power Enable Key Carlo Caione
[not found] ` <1397209093-10077-5-git-send-email-carlo-KA+7E9HrN00dnm+yROfE0A@public.gmane.org>
2014-04-13 8:17 ` Dmitry Torokhov
2014-04-17 12:07 ` [linux-sunxi] " Carlo Caione
2014-04-11 9:38 ` [PATCH v4 5/9] input: misc: Add ABI docs for AXP20x PEK Carlo Caione
2014-04-11 9:38 ` [PATCH v4 6/9] regulator: AXP20x: Add support for regulators subsystem Carlo Caione
[not found] ` <1397209093-10077-7-git-send-email-carlo-KA+7E9HrN00dnm+yROfE0A@public.gmane.org>
2014-04-11 12:23 ` Mark Brown
2014-04-11 12:29 ` [linux-sunxi] " Carlo Caione
2014-05-15 18:03 ` Boris BREZILLON
[not found] ` <5375015A.10701-wi1+55ScJUtKEb57/3fJTNBPR1lH4CV8@public.gmane.org>
2014-05-15 18:18 ` Mark Brown
2014-05-16 7:40 ` Carlo Caione
2014-04-11 9:38 ` [PATCH v4 7/9] ARM: sun7i/sun4i: dt: Add AXP209 support to various boards Carlo Caione
[not found] ` <1397209093-10077-8-git-send-email-carlo-KA+7E9HrN00dnm+yROfE0A@public.gmane.org>
2014-04-11 12:29 ` Mark Brown
2014-04-11 13:04 ` Carlo Caione
[not found] ` <CAOQ7t2Y2B7f+eZApDHKiKm9=bOXo6oUA2RLY7ENn7qPLQEboMA-JsoAwUIsXosN+BqQ9rBEUg@public.gmane.org>
2014-04-11 16:18 ` Mark Brown
[not found] ` <20140411161813.GF28800-GFdadSzt00ze9xe1eoZjHA@public.gmane.org>
2014-04-17 10:06 ` Carlo Caione
[not found] ` <CAOQ7t2YO_MjUZkkoEe1Grft+fVttWoOro85Sru2P3LXbx8Kjbg-JsoAwUIsXosN+BqQ9rBEUg@public.gmane.org>
2014-04-18 15:15 ` Mark Brown
[not found] ` <20140418151551.GZ12304-GFdadSzt00ze9xe1eoZjHA@public.gmane.org>
2014-04-23 20:25 ` Carlo Caione
[not found] ` <20140423202546.GA3890-OP/Sd6KM9CusbfqNwF1Yyl6hYfS7NtTn@public.gmane.org>
2014-04-24 13:30 ` Mark Brown
2014-04-24 16:35 ` Charles Keepax [this message]
[not found] ` <20140424163523.GB25663-yzvPICuk2AATkU/dhu1WVueM+bqZidxxQQ4Iyu8u01E@public.gmane.org>
2014-04-24 16:58 ` Charles Keepax
[not found] ` <20140424165847.GC25663-yzvPICuk2AATkU/dhu1WVueM+bqZidxxQQ4Iyu8u01E@public.gmane.org>
2014-04-24 17:12 ` Mark Brown
2014-04-14 9:52 ` Maxime Ripard
2014-04-14 10:02 ` Carlo Caione
[not found] ` <CAOQ7t2ZybF=dm-NBQ3niN7gb-Asgwz5CW-VSkOzWR6t2NCaA8w-JsoAwUIsXosN+BqQ9rBEUg@public.gmane.org>
2014-04-14 10:20 ` Hans de Goede
[not found] ` <534BB670.8030102-H+wXaHxf7aLQT0dZR+AlfA@public.gmane.org>
2014-04-14 11:16 ` Mark Brown
2014-04-11 9:38 ` [PATCH v4 8/9] ARM: sunxi: Add AXP20x support in defconfig Carlo Caione
2014-04-11 9:38 ` [PATCH v4 9/9] ARM: sunxi: Add AXP20x support multi_v7_defconfig Carlo Caione
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=20140424163523.GB25663@opensource.wolfsonmicro.com \
--to=ckeepax@opensource.wolfsonmicro.com \
--cc=boris.brezillon@free-electrons.com \
--cc=broonie@kernel.org \
--cc=carlo@caione.org \
--cc=dmitry.torokhov@gmail.com \
--cc=emilio@elopez.com.ar \
--cc=hdegoede@redhat.com \
--cc=lee.jones@linaro.org \
--cc=lgirdwood@gmail.com \
--cc=linux-arm-kernel@lists.infradead.org \
--cc=linux-doc@vger.kernel.org \
--cc=linux-input@vger.kernel.org \
--cc=linux-sunxi@googlegroups.com \
--cc=maxime.ripard@free-electrons.com \
--cc=sameo@linux.intel.com \
--cc=wens@csie.org \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).